    Just an FYI in case you notice docker image utilization rising.  The last two unifi-controller updates I have done left behind orphan images.  These are not visible unless you go into the Advanced View on the Docker page in the unRAID WebUI.

     

    Deleting these two orphan images reduced my docker image utilization by 7%.

     

    Not every update will necessarily result in orphan images but in my case it did.  It is worth checking.

  10. Successfully upgraded Unifi Controller from 5.14.23-ls76 to 7.1.66 by changing the repository field to linuxserver/unifi-controller:7.1.66.

    All six sites with Unifi AP AC Pro and Lite  devices are now running firmware 6.0.15 (upgraded from 4.0.54) prior to upgrading the controller software to 7.1.66.  Looks like everything is running smoothly, let's hope things remain stable.  If so, I should be set for another 3 years🤞


    Not a big fan of the screen real estate waste of the new GUI.  I prefer the more condense view so I can display more columns without having to scroll horizontally.  Another peeve is now it is harder to determine which site I am looking at since the site name is no longer displayed.
